We only evaluate campers that we have personally seen at a Kohl's camp. In order to assure yourself a ranking you must attend a Kohl's Showcase camp or the Scholarship camp.

When ranking we ask the question, "If there was a college game today, is this athlete ready to help a college team win?". We look at the camp charts and take into account the different conditions at each camp. We also look strongly at how an athlete performs in drill work when they know they are being evaluated and graded. We see how they handle pressure and react in the camp competitions. We see certain athletes multiple times a year and try to grade them on their average performance.

Kohl's sees more athletes than anyone else in America at our 135 events.

There will be over 300 Kohl's high school seniors playing college football next season. There are many good prospects at the 4.0 and 4.5 star levels that will start in college in the future.

Jachimek came out to the 2024 Kohl's Midwest Showcase Camp in December. It was his first ranking event. Jachimek scored 6 points on field goals and has a nice "A" ball. He scored 73.30 points on kickoff charting with a big ball of 45 yards with 2.86 seconds of hang time. Jachimek has good swing mechanics as a field goal kicker and a good foundation. Continued efforts on his mechanics will aid his development over the next few seasons. We are eager to follow Jachimek's progress.

    DiGilarmo recently competed at his first ranking event, the 2024 Kohl's Southern Winter Showcase. He is a younger athlete, but he showed good poise in tough weather and stiff competition. Hitting the weights and continuing to focus on his refinement the next 4 years will be key for his continued development. He showed solid ball striking skills and was able to chart two points in the field goal charting. His overall score on kickoffs was 67.45. His biggest charted kickoff was 43 yards with 2.60 seconds of hang time.

      Rhys Poggio attended the 2025 Kohl's Spring Ranking Event. He connected on one field goal and earned a kickoff score of 90.70. His best ball traveled 57 yards with a 3.48-second hang time. With continued focus on refining his technique, Poggio has the tools to improve his overall kicking consistency and power.

        Wehner competed at the 2024 Kohl's Southern Winter Showcase, where he made 2 field goals. He recorded an 82.60 kickoff score with a best ball of 54 yards and a 2.92-second hang time. He also earned a 76.41 punt score. Focusing on strength training and ball striking consistency during the offseason could help him improve his skills. Wehner is a very young athlete with good potential for future growth.
